"In the last 13 years we have produced an average of 4700 hybrids per year. We collect 80000 seeds, out of which 60000 come from ‘controlled’ open pollinations. The largest families have 250-300 hybrids" says Dr. José Manuel Donoso of INIA Rayantué.

Meda™ varieties have been evaluated in Europe for three seasons now. All have been selected with a minimum of 35-40 days post-harvest. Meda™'s is the only breeding programme that has used postharvest as a selection filter.

Despite the fact its manifests similarly to other Rosaceae species, GSI in sour cherries is more complex due to tetraploidy and the presence of pollen-part and stylar-part mutants that cause genetic changes at S-locus.
